The global ultrasonic air‑in‑line sensor market was valued at USD 77.8 million in 2022 and is forecast to expand at a CAGR of 4.8% from 2023 to 2031, reaching approximately USD 118.3 million by the end of the forecast period. These sensors leverage ultrasonic technology to detect air bubbles in fluid lines of medical equipment an essential failsafe to prevent air embolism during critical procedures such as surgery, dialysis, and transfusions.

 

Market Drivers & Trends

  • Rise in Prevalence of Chronic Diseases: Sedentary lifestyles, environmental pollution, harmful habits (smoking, alcohol), and genetic predispositions have elevated incidence rates of asthma, hepatitis, kidney, and cardiovascular diseases. The U.S. CDC reports that nearly 50% of American adults live with at least one chronic disease, while projections indicate that by 2040, 40% of U.S. residents will be aged 60 or above augmenting demand for reliable fluid‑delivery safety systems.
  • Technological Advancements: Investment in medical equipment R&D approximately 3.3% of total U.S. healthcare spending, equating to US$ 121.8 billion has prioritized miniaturization, IoT integration, AI‑driven diagnostics, and improved portability. These trends are catalyzing development of compact, high‑precision ultrasonic probes suited for ambulatory and remote healthcare settings.
  • Regulatory Focus on Patient Safety: Regulatory bodies worldwide are tightening standards for medical device performance. Sensors that ensure zero‑bubble introduction align with stringent safety protocols, gaining traction among OEMs and healthcare providers alike.

 

Latest Market Trends

  • Shift to Compact and Miniature Designs: Healthcare providers seek low‑footprint sensors to conserve space and simplify integration into modular medical systems.
  • IoT‑Enabled Remote Monitoring: Wireless connectivity and cloud platforms allow clinicians to oversee infusion processes from centralized dashboards, reducing manual checks and accelerating response to anomalies.
  • Disposable and Sterile Solutions: Single‑use sensor cartridges minimize cross‑contamination risks, aligning with heightened infection‑control measures, particularly in home care environments.

Recent Developments

  • January 2024: A patent application by Apple Inc. revealed a novel ultrasonic temperature sensor design capable of detecting changes in non‑electrical media—including blood and glass—potentially adaptable for air‑bubble detection in medical devices.
  • Q1 2024 Collaborations: SONOTEC GmbH announced a research partnership with a major U.S. OEM to integrate AI analytics into its inline sensors for predictive maintenance and real‑time bubble size quantification.
  • New Product Launches: In March 2024, TE Connectivity introduced a miniaturized, disposable ultrasonic probe for single‑use infusion sets, targeting cost‑sensitive home care and outpatient facilities.

Regional Insights

  • North America: Held the largest market share in 2022, driven by advanced healthcare infrastructure, high R&D investments, and early adoption of sensorized automation. U.S. federal funding for AI in healthcare exceeded US$ 3.3 billion in FY 2022, while robotic process automation received over US$ 5.4 billion, reinforcing technology uptake.
  • Europe: Steady growth anticipated through 2031, with strong manufacturing capabilities and emphasis on industrial automation supporting market expansion.
  • Asia Pacific: Fastest CAGR expected, propelled by rising healthcare expenditure, expanding private hospital networks, and government initiatives to upgrade medical infrastructure in China, India, and ASEAN nations.
  • Latin America & MEA: Gradual uptake in urban centers; potential for high‑impact entry through partnerships with regional distributors and mobile health clinics.
